Problems with the power-door lock actuator

If you've heard noises from your power door lock actuator, you may have an issue. It could be that the power door lock isn't getting enough power. It could also not stop moving, draining the battery. It is recommended for you to get the power door lock actuator examined by a professional in the event that it is suspect. The repair usually doesn't take long, but the technician may have to order parts and wait for a few days for them to arrive.

The most common problem with door lock actuators powered by electricity is that they operate intermittently. This is when the driver is unable to see the lock moving , but cannot disconnect it. The only solution to fix the actuator is to replace it. This is a simple fix and most automotive actuators can be purchased at a reasonable price.

You must first test the door lock's power using a test lamp or automotive meter. It should display 12 V across the electrical connector. If the meter is showing a negative reading, then it's highly likely that the actuator motor or solenoid is the culprit.

Corrosion and damage are another typical issue for power door lock actuators. The mechanic must inspect every part of the door lock actuator that were damaged in a collision , to make sure they're not broken. Damaged parts may cause the door lock actuator to stop working.

To test the actuator of the power door lock replacement near me, remove the cover from the lock. The actuator is secured by two bolts. The L-shaped pin on the cover is the one to unscrew. Next, disconnect the cable that connects the actuator to the door lock's power source.

Cost of a door lock powered by actuator

The power door lock actuator is an electronic door lock repair near me device that activates when you open or shut the door of your car. It is therefore susceptible to failure or damage. An actuator may have to be replaced based on the make and model of your vehicle, and also the mileage you've traveled.

A mechanic should be consulted if your door lock actuator is in need of repair. Repairing a door lock actuator can be expensive and not recommended for maintenance on a regular basis. It is recommended to replace only the power door lock actuator when it ceases to function. The price varies depending on the type of vehicle you own. It can cost between $200 and $300 for a basic car, but can exceed seven hundred dollars for exotic vehicles.

Power door operation that is intermittent is the most common problem with actuators for power doors. Drivers might be able to see the lock moving but not enough to disengage it. This implies that the door lock actuator that powers the door must be replaced or the entire latch assembly will have to be replaced. Even though newer, more integrated parts are generally more expensive, the process is easy and affordable for cars that are domestic.

A power door lock actuator is an electric motor, gears and an electric a linkage that move to open and close the doors. If the driver's side door lock isn't working, it's likely the door lock actuator has an electrical issue. Sometimes, the wire is covered in plastic, which can cause the short.

If the door lock's power actuator is damaged It is possible to test the door lock mechanism by using a power probe or jumper wire. However, it is important to be careful with electrical parts since they can be difficult to reach. The replacement will cost money, but it will be worth it when your door locks are working again.
